Research master in Clinical Research
Master of Science in Clinical Research (MSc)
Patient care and clinical research: what a combination. Learn both how to produce the best diagnoses and provide the best treatment, and get ready for a dual career as a clinician and a researcher.
No two patients are the same. Learn how to do the clinical trials and test the methods that group both patients and diseases, and contribute to future possibilities for individual diagnoses and therapies.
This researchmaster is the result of a partnership between Netherlands Institute for Health Sciences (NIHES), the Cardiovascular Research School (COEUR) and Molecular Medicine School (MolMed) at Erasmus MC. Pursue research opportunities in a range of fields such as endocrinology, cardiovascular research, various subfields in oncology, pediatrics, obstetrics, urology, transplantation medicine, gastroenterology and hepatology, surgical research, and musculoskeletal science. Get methodological and practical training, and go on to a career researching a wide range of subjects, or in an executive or advisory position in drug research or health policy.

Target audience Research Master in Clinical Research
| Ambitious students with a bachelor degree in medicine, who want to help to improve diagnosis and treatment through research, sign up for the master programme Clinical Research at Erasmus MC. Your path to success as a clinician, intern involved in research or as a medical scientist. Every patient is different; every diagnosis is, too. |
Admission criteria Research Master in Clinical Research
| You are a medical or nanobiology student of Erasmus MC. |
Application Research Master in Clinical Research
| A motivation letter explaining the reasons why students wish to participate in the programme is required. The selection procedure may also include an interview in English.
